djc: Nvu/Composer - what's the difference?
glazou: Nvu is a registered trademark by Linspire and is not xulrunner-based
brade & mcs: Will Mozilla Composer have similar goals and features as Nvu?
glazou: brade: yes, plus new features
glazou: Composer will be hosted by cvs.mozilla.org and is a xulrunner app

paul: Composer is currently based on Toolkit, right ? or XPFE ?
glazou: paul: Nvu is based on 80% toolkit and 20% xpfe
glazou: M/C will be based solely on toolkit

djc: “glazou: 799: aaaaah, that's a longstanding question and that's incredibly hard” - what are the disadvantages of implementing XUL editing? Too much work? Out of the scope of Composer?
Laurentj: djc: XUL is not only a markup language, but also a xbl based language
glazou: djc: there are a lot of problems with dynamic XUL
Laurentj: so it is difficult to do a wysiwyg editor for that
